Abstract

Lattice deformations along the principal axes (η1, η2 and η3) associated with the B2–B19 transformation in Ti–30Ni–20Cu(at.%) alloy ribbons were found to be 0.9556, 0.9921 and 1.0482, respectively. The maximum recoverable elongation and transformation hysteresis associated with the B2–B19 transformation were 3.4% and 4 K, respectively. Superelastic recovery occurred in the temperature range 338–403 K.
